Kitty litter brand tweets apology for stinky billboard
4/12/2012Tidy Cats has really stepped in it with a billboard that labeled a Cincinnati neighborhood smellier than the manufacturer's odor-erasing litter. As part of its "No More PU" campaign highlighting things that "stink," the Purina-owned brand erected a billboard in Cincy's historically troubled but revitalizing Over-the-Rhine neighborhood. The billboard read: "You're so over Over-The-Rhine. #lifestinks." Residents got their backs up and fur flew across the social media landscape. Purina swiftly tweeted its regrets, promising a quick remedy. Sure enough, the offending billboard has been replaced with an ad promoting pet adoption.
